Publications

  • Musicke of Sundrie Kindes, (1607)
  1. Not full twelve yeares
  2. What then is love
  3. Unto the temple
  4. Now I see thy lookes were fained
  5. Goe passions
  6. Come, Phyllis
  7. Faire, sweet, cruell
  8. Since first I saw your face
  9. There is a Ladie
  10. How shall I then
  11. A Dialogue
